package builds
import (
"fmt"
"net"
"strings"
g "github.com/onsi/ginkgo"
o "github.com/onsi/gomega"
metav1 "k8s.io/apimachinery/pkg/apis/meta/v1"
exutil "github.com/openshift/origin/test/extended/util"
)
// hostname returns the hostname from a hostport specification
func hostname(hostport string) (string, error) {
host, _, err := net.SplitHostPort(hostport)
return host, err
}
var _ = g.Describe("[Feature:Builds][Slow] can use private repositories as build input", func() {
defer g.GinkgoRecover()
const (
gitServerDeploymentConfigName = "gitserver"
sourceSecretName = "sourcesecret"
gitUserName = "gituser"
gitPassword = "gituserpassword"
buildConfigName = "gitauthtest"
sourceURLTemplate = "https://%s/ruby-hello-world"
)
var (
gitServerFixture = exutil.FixturePath("testdata", "test-gitserver.yaml")
testBuildFixture = exutil.FixturePath("testdata", "builds", "test-auth-build.yaml")
oc = exutil.NewCLI("build-sti-private-repo", exutil.KubeConfigPath())
)
g.Context("", func() {
g.BeforeEach(func() {
exutil.PreTestDump()
})
g.AfterEach(func() {
if g.CurrentGinkgoTestDescription().Failed {
exutil.DumpPodStates(oc)
exutil.DumpConfigMapStates(oc)
exutil.DumpPodLogsStartingWith("", oc)
}
})
testGitAuth := func(routeName, gitServerYaml, urlTemplate string, secretFunc func() string) {
err := oc.Run("new-app").Args("-f", gitServerYaml).Execute()
o.Expect(err).NotTo(o.HaveOccurred())
g.By("expecting the deployment of the gitserver to be in the Complete phase")
err = exutil.WaitForDeploymentConfig(oc.KubeClient(), oc.AppsClient().AppsV1(), oc.Namespace(), gitServerDeploymentConfigName, 1, true, oc)
o.Expect(err).NotTo(o.HaveOccurred())
sourceSecretName := secretFunc()
route, err := oc.AdminRouteClient().Route().Routes(oc.Namespace()).Get(routeName, metav1.GetOptions{})
o.Expect(err).NotTo(o.HaveOccurred())
sourceURL := fmt.Sprintf(urlTemplate, route.Spec.Host)
g.By(fmt.Sprintf("creating a new BuildConfig by calling oc new-app -f %q -p SOURCE_SECRET=%s -p SOURCE_URL=%s",
testBuildFixture, sourceSecretName, sourceURL))
err = oc.Run("new-app").Args("-f", testBuildFixture, "-p", fmt.Sprintf("SOURCE_SECRET=%s", sourceSecretName), "-p", fmt.Sprintf("SOURCE_URL=%s", sourceURL)).Execute()
o.Expect(err).NotTo(o.HaveOccurred())
g.By("starting a test build")
br, _ := exutil.StartBuildAndWait(oc, buildConfigName)
if !br.BuildSuccess {
exutil.DumpApplicationPodLogs(gitServerDeploymentConfigName, oc)
}
br.AssertSuccess()
}
g.Describe("Build using a username and password", func() {
g.It("should create a new build using the internal gitserver", func() {
g.Skip("Need to fetch router CA via https://github.com/openshift/cluster-ingress-operator/pull/111")
testGitAuth("gitserver", gitServerFixture, sourceURLTemplate, func() string {
g.By(fmt.Sprintf("creating a new secret for the gitserver by calling oc secrets new-basicauth %s --username=%s --password=%s",
sourceSecretName, gitUserName, gitPassword))
sa, err := oc.KubeClient().CoreV1().ServiceAccounts(oc.Namespace()).Get("builder", metav1.GetOptions{})
o.Expect(err).NotTo(o.HaveOccurred())
for _, s := range sa.Secrets {
if strings.Contains(s.Name, "token") {
secret, err := oc.KubeClient().CoreV1().Secrets(oc.Namespace()).Get(s.Name, metav1.GetOptions{})
o.Expect(err).NotTo(o.HaveOccurred())
err = oc.Run("create").Args(
"secret",
"generic",
sourceSecretName,
"--type", "kubernetes.io/basic-auth",
"--from-literal", fmt.Sprintf("username=%s", gitUserName),
"--from-literal", fmt.Sprintf("password=%s", gitPassword),
// TODO this needs to come from https://github.com/openshift/cluster-ingress-operator/pull/111 instead
"--from-literal", fmt.Sprintf("ca.crt=%s", string(secret.Data["service-ca.crt"])),
).Execute()
o.Expect(err).NotTo(o.HaveOccurred())
return sourceSecretName
}
}
return ""
})
})
})
})
})
